AI Summary

  • Requires building permits for new buildings to include proof of ability to withstand Category 4 hurricanes, effective January 1, 2022.

  • Requires state government agencies to obtain building permits for work on all new public buildings, with new public buildings designed to withstand Category 5 hurricanes, effective January 1, 2022.

  • Amends Hawaii Revised Statutes Chapter 107 to modify design requirements for public buildings and establish hurricane resistance standards.

  • Allows state building construction exemptions from certain county codes that have not adopted Hawaii state building codes or contain amendments inconsistent with state standards.

  • Effective date of July 1, 2050, meaning implementation is delayed approximately 29 years from the stated January 1, 2022 effective dates in the bill's substantive provisions.
